Lead Engineer - Robotics & Autonomous Systems

GE VernovaTown of Niskayuna, NY
22hOnsite

About The Position

In this position, you will work with GE Vernova Advanced Research Center, GE Vernova Businesses, and external customers to define, build, and execute strategic research and development programs focused on Robotics and Autonomous Systems aligned with GE Vernova’s vision.

Responsibilities

  • Develop new technology concepts with strategic impact focused in robotics and autonomy, including design, analysis, integration and testing of electromechanical systems, mechanical, and fluidic (pneumatic/hydraulic) systems, motion planning, perception, manipulation, and human-robot interaction.
  • Lead projects, proposals, relationship building, and the development of new autonomous and robotic systems technology.
  • Lead design, selection, analysis, system integration/packaging and testing of electromechanical components and systems, including sensors, actuators, controllers, pneumatic and hydraulic systems, and electromechanical systems, including conceptual design, detailed design, testing, validation, and product implementation.
  • Actively participate in design, architecture, and development efforts.
  • Engage with internal and external thought leaders across the robotics technology stack to drive new concepts and applications.
